Sugar Tongs

Possibly by: Samuel Wintle (first mark entered 1778)
English (London)
about 1790
Object Place: Europe, London, England

Medium/Technique Silver
Dimensions 4.8 x 14 cm (1 7/8 x 5 1/2 in.)
Weight: 34 gm (1 oz)
Credit Line Gift of Mary Adelaide Sargent Poor in memory of Adelaide Joanna Sargent
Accession Number47.1352
NOT ON VIEW
CollectionsEurope
ClassificationsSilver

DescriptionThe U-shaped tongs are formed from a single piece of silver, with shaped oval grippers, flat arms and bright-cut ornament on the outer edges enclosing a medallion.
Marks On inside of one arm, maker's mark SW (possibly Grimwade 2662). Inside the other arm, lion passant; sovereign's head.
InscriptionsEngraved on top of tongs, in monogram "MB".
ProvenanceGift of Mary Adelaide Sargent Poor to the MFA in memory of Adelaide Joanna Sargent. (Accession Date: Septemebr 18, 1947)
